Rate of Change (ROC)

View as Markdown

Description

The Rate of Change (ROC) indicator is a very simple yet effective momentum oscillator that measures the percent change in price from one period to the next. The ROC calculation compares the current price with the price n periods ago.

Syntax

ROC(int period)

ROC(ISeries\<double\> input, int period)

Returns default value

ROC(int period)[int barsAgo]

ROC(ISeries\<double\> input, int period)[int barsAgo]

Return Value

double; Accessing this method via an index value [int barsAgo] returns the indicator value of the referenced bar.

Parameters

ParameterDescription
inputIndicator source data (Series<T>)
periodNumber of bars used in the calculation

Examples

1Prints the current value of a 20 period ROC using default price type
2double value = ROC(20)[0];
3Print("The current ROC value is " + value.ToString());
4
5// Prints the current value of a 20 period ROC using high price type
6double value = ROC(High, 20)[0];
7Print("The current ROC value is " + value.ToString());
